Web18 feb. 2024 · Marine algae, commonly called seaweed, provides food and shelter for marine life. Algae also provide the bulk of the Earth's oxygen supply through photosynthesis. But there is also a myriad of human uses for algae. We use algae for food, medicine, and even to combat climate change. Algae may even be used to produce fuel. WebThe list expands to include algae, mollusks (e.g., Cypraea moneta, Sepia officinalis, Aplysia sp. ), crustaceans (e.g., Cancer marina, Crangon vulgaris), sponges (e.g., Spongia officinalis, ), echinoderms ( Echinus marinus ), fish (e.g., Anguilla sp ), reptiles (e.g., Chelonia mydas ), and mammals ( e.g., Monodon monoceros ).
